
Critically-acclaimed action-RPG that takes the template laid down by classics like Wonder Boy, nails the 16-Bit aesthetics for nostalgia fans, but updates the mechanics to feel fresh and modern. Explore a beautiful open world and plunder dungeons, caves and forests to help take down epic bosses!

Aggelos is an absolutely excellent evolution of the Wonder Boy formula. For some reason, modern gamers seem to ignore the Wonder Boy games, in particular, Wonder Boy 3 The Dragon's Trap, which is so much more fluid and interesting than Super Metroid to me. But anyway, Aggelos takes that excellent formula and ramps it all up to another level. It is really a fantastic Metroidvania in its own right with a superb blend of action and puzzles, great enemy patterns, including the bosses, great level structuring, and it's mostly well balanced too. My biggest complaint with it is that it doesn't allow you to use a standard D-pad, you have to use an analog pad, and that feels weird. I've spent 40 odd years playing these types of games with D-pads, so having to switch to an analog pad now just gets in the way of me completely immersing myself in the game. But it's a minor complaint with what has to be for me one of my favourite games of the 2020s so far. In fact, I would say it's only third to Earthion and Skald Against the Black Priory. Definitely worth buying.
[h1]Aggelos: Маленькое письмо любви 8-битной эпохе[/h1] Если вы застали эпоху Sega Master System или первые часы за NES, то Aggelos пробудит в вас острую ностальгию с первых же секунд. Это не просто игра в стиле «ретро» — это практически утерянный сиквел Wonder Boy in Monster World, выполненный с огромным уважением к первоисточнику. [b]Очарование простоты[/b] Сюжет здесь классический и незамысловатый: зло пробуждается, принцесса в беде, а вы — избранный герой с мечом, которому предстоит собрать магические стихии и спасти королевство. Никаких запутанных сюжетных твистов или моральных дилемм, только чистое приключение. [b]Геймплей: В ритме «вжух-вжух»[/b] Основа игры — это динамичные сражения и исследование мира. Боевая система интуитивна: у вас есть быстрый удар мечом, блок и расходуемая магия. По мере прохождения вы получаете новые способности (двойной прыжок, рывок, возможность плавать), которые классическим для жанра образом открывают ранее недоступные локации. Мир игры компактный, но насыщенный секретами. Вам постоянно придется возвращаться в старые локации, чтобы найти скрытые сундуки с улучшениями здоровья или маны. Сложность ощутимая, но не карающая: смерть отбрасывает вас к последней контрольной точке с сохранением прогресса, так что игра подталкивает к экспериментам, а не наказывает за них. [b]Картинка и звук[/b] Визуально Aggelos безупречен. Яркая, сочная пиксельная графика выглядит так, словно кто-то выжал из 8-битной палитры максимум. Фоны пестрят деталями, а враги и персонажи анимированы плавно и с душой. Музыкальное сопровождение — отдельный вид удовольствия. Чиптюн-мелодии настолько мелодичны и энергичны, что их хочется слушать отдельно от игры. Они идеально ложатся на темп исследования подземелий и жарких битв с боссами. [b]Вердикт[/b] Aggelos — это не «еще одна инди-метроидвания», а [u]крепкий представитель жанра[/u], который знает свои корни. Она не пытается казаться умнее или больше, чем она есть. Это чистая, светлая и очень уютная игра, которая дарит ровно то, что обещает: несколько часов искренней радости от пиксельного приключения. 9 желтых слаймов из 10

Es de valorar el gran esfuerzo y cariño que le ha puesto el creador de este juego y me parece que es una sola persona. No voy a decirte que Aggelos es un mal juego porque no lo es. Pero creo que es un juego que no cumple mis expectativas en cuanto a un título de metroidvania se trata y voy a explicarte por qué. 1. El sistema de combate no es bueno. Básicamente la mayor dificultad del juego es el daño por contacto, lo que reduce el combate a aguantar daño y golpear o moverte y golpear. 2. La historia es la misma de siempre. La del héroe salvando el reino de las fuerzas del mal. 3. Los NPC's tienen momentos buenos, pero demasiado cortos. La inmersión en el juego se vuelve casi nula. 4. La música no es memorable. Un metroidvania o un juego de pixel art o indie merece un gran tema, aunque sea muy difícil conseguirlo. 5. Poco novedoso, no trae nada nuevo a un subgénero que ya lo ha explorado casi todo. 6. Los jefes. Los jefes no tienen personalidad, salvo quizás Valion, un poquito, pero algo. Salvo que busques un reto no hit, los combates con los jefes se sienten como tanquear y hacer el máximo daño posible. 7. La exploración. Aggelos carece de un mapa tipo metroidvania. Básicamente te reduce a memorizar puntos claves del juego o recurrir a guías. Creo que nunca he sido tan crítico con una reseña, pero es que sí me fastidió un poco, porque siento que este juego tenía mucho potencial, quizás en una segunda entrega puedan mejorar todas las cosas, pues también es entendible que una sola persona pueda hacer tanto. Los gráficos tipo NES son muy agradables. Y valoro mucho los retos a pesar de que algunos se sientan muy complicados, pero esa dificultad siempre es agradable y más cuando es opcional y depende del jugador si quiere o no afrontarlos. También debo reconocer mucho el trabajo de este gran hombre. Discúlpame por ser tan pesado, buen hombre, pero a fin de cuentas es la opinión de un simple usuario y espero que no lo tome a mal y, al contrario, puedan servirle para mejorar en el gran talento que tiene como diseñador de videojuegos.

Don't get me wrong is somehow good, but it tries to be so accurate to Monster World that the developer forgot to add modern quality of life imrpvements into it that I'll mention in: The Good: -Simople but effectie story -Nice omage to 8-bit graphics The Bad: -The ammount of grinding to be strong enough to not do 100 slashes to kill a regular enemy is absurd. -The chiptune is so simple, short and repetitive that becomes annoying The Ugly: -It has a slide when you stop walking or press attack making it super annoying -The pushback when hit doesn't stop even if you hit a wall -You can't cut the attack animation for a kick evade
